LLM Applications LLM Themes Are Not Observations A practitioner's warning about generated variables in causal analysis William Gieng May 21, 2026 15 min read Share Image by Claude An analyst joins LLM-extracted themes from a call corpus to the customer table. Customers without transcripts get NULL. NULL gets filled with zero, or with “no issue mentioned,” or quietly omitted as a reference category. In one line of preprocessing, the pipeline converts did not call support into did not experience billing frustration. The regression that follows looks clean. The coefficient on “billing frustration” is significant, signed the way the product team expected, large enough to matter. It gets pasted into a roadmap document. Nobody asks where the variable came from.
